Report Office Activity to Remain Steady in 2012Office leasing activity is likely to remain steady in 2012, as election year uncertainty year has tenants renewing and expanding in order to maintain their currently low rates, says Grubb & Ellis research manager Dave Dworkin. Tenants have an abundant amount of opportunity to relocate to a more favorable submarket at historically low rental rates, as landlords continue to offer free rent to avoid lowering asking rates.
